Texas Instruments MSP430F532x Mixed-Signal Microcontrollers (MCUs)
Texas Instruments MSP430F532x Mixed-Signal Microcontrollers (MCUs) are ultra-low-power MCUs that are configured with an integrated 3.3V LDO, four 16-bit timers, a high-performance 12-bit ADC, and two USCIs. These devices include a hardware multiplier, DMA, and an RTC module with alarm capabilities. The Texas Instruments MSP430F5328, MSP430F5326, and MSP430F5324 include all these peripherals but have 47 I/O pins. The devices feature a powerful 16-bit RISC CPU, 16-bit registers, and constant generators, contributing to maximum code efficiency. The digitally controlled oscillator (DCO) allows the devices to wake up from low-power to active mode in 3.5µs (typical). The MSP430F532x-EP devices have gold bond wires, a temperature range of –55 to +105°C, and a SnPb lead finish.Features
- Low supply voltage range of 3.6V down to 1.8V
- Ultra-low power consumption
- Active mode (AM) - All system clocks active 290µA/MHz at 8MHz, 3V, flash program execution (typical) 150µA/MHz at 8MHz, 3V, RAM program execution (typical)
- Standby mode (LPM3) - Real-time clock (RTC) with crystal, watchdog, and supply supervisor operational, full RAM retention, fast wake-up: 1.9µA at 2.2V, 2.1µA at 3V (typical) low-power oscillator (VLO), general-purpose counter, watchdog, and supply supervisor operational, full RAM retention, fast wake-up: 1.4µA at 3V (typical)
- Off mode (LPM4) - Full RAM retention, supply supervisor operational, fast wake-up: 1.1µA at 3V (typical)
- Shutdown mode (LPM4.5) - 0.18µA at 3V (typical)
- Wake up from standby mode in 3.5µs (typical)
- 16-bit RISC architecture, extended memory, up to 25MHz system clock
- Flexible power-management system
- Fully integrated LDO with programmable regulated core supply voltage
- Supply voltage supervision, monitoring, and brownout
- Unified clock system
- FLL control loop for frequency stabilization
- Low-power, low-frequency internal clock source (VLO)
- Low-frequency trimmed internal reference source (REFO)
- 32-kHz watch crystals (XT1)
- High-frequency crystals up to 32MHz (XT2)
- 16-bit timer TA0, Timer_A with five capture/compare registers
- 16-bit timer TA1, Timer_A with three capture/compare registers
- 16-bit timer TA2, Timer_A with three capture/compare registers
- 16-bit timer TB0, Timer_B with seven capture/compare shadow registers
- Two universal serial communication interfaces (USCIs)
- USCI_A0 and USCI_A1 each support the following:
- Enhanced UART supports automatic baud-rate detection
- IrDA encoder and decoder
- Synchronous SPI
- USCI_B0 and USCI_B1 each support the following:
- I2C
- Synchronous SPI

- Integrated 3.3V power system
- 12-bit analog-to-digital converter (ADC) with internal reference, sample-and-hold, and auto-scan feature
- Comparator
- Hardware multiplier supports 32-bit operations
- Serial onboard programming, no external programming voltage needed
- 3-channel internal DMA
- Basic timer with RTC feature
Applications
- Analog and digital sensor systems
- Data loggers
- General-purpose applications
